Homeowners With Properties in Poor Condition
North Richland Hills has substantial housing stock from the 1960s through the 1980s, and a meaningful portion of those homes have deferred maintenance that has accumulated over years. Foundation issues are particularly common in Tarrant County due to the expansive clay soils, and older electrical systems, plumbing, and HVAC units frequently need attention or replacement before a home can compete on the retail market. Why Listing on the Open Market Is Not Always the Right Choice in NRH
The open market works best for sellers who have a home in move-in-ready condition, the ability to wait two to four months for the right buyer, the financial flexibility to absorb agent commissions and closing costs, and the tolerance for the uncertainty that comes with a contingent transaction. When any of those conditions are missing, the traditional process can feel unnecessarily punishing.
In North Richland Hills, many homes that might generate strong buyer interest if fully updated struggle on the open market in their current as-is condition. Buyers who discover a home at a reasonable price quickly discount their offer once an inspection reveals the true repair scope. Seller and buyer agents are skilled at handling these negotiations, but they can still drag on for two to three weeks while the seller waits anxiously. Even after reaching agreement, the transaction can fall apart if the buyer’s lender gets cold feet about the property’s condition.

Q6: Is a cash offer for my NRH home taxable?
The tax treatment of proceeds from a home sale depends on your individual circumstances, including how long you owned the home, whether it was your primary residence, and the capital gains exclusion thresholds.
